COMBINATION TOP FOR GAS RANGES.
Application filed November 17, 1927. Serial No. 233,904.
My invention relates to combination open and closed tops for gas ranges.
Heretofore gas ranges have been made with open tops or kettle rests to give better ventilation and combustion and quicker heating, or with closed tops, which, while not so eilicient as to ventilation, combustion and heat ing, permit the whole top to be heated by one or less than the whole number of, usually four, burners.
Gas ranges have also been proposed with interchangeable open and closed tops, and with circular kettle openings to be closed by circular lids.
My invention consists of a combination open and closed top having the advantages in both adjustments of the open top in re spect to perfect ventilation and combustion and effective heating, and comprises as an entirety, in its present referred embodiment, a range top having urner openings and fingers serving as open kettle rests projecting by preference radially into said openings, and removable lids to cover said openings and serve as closed kettle rests, said lids having radial outward projections to fill in the spaces between the inwardly projecting fingers or open kettle rests.
I may make the corresponding edges of the fixed inward and movable outward projections correspondingly beveled downwardly and inwardly but spaced to assist ventilation, combustion and heating, or I may make the corresponding beveled edges close fitting but scalloped or indented to assist ventilation, combustion and heating, as hereinafter more fully described.

In the embodiment of my invention shown in Figures 1 and 2, number 4 designates the solid top of a gas range, which may have small ventilating openings therein as shown.
, and I may make said several openings 5 separate or connected as desired. Each fingered opening 5, is provided with a removable lid 7 cast integrally with outward projections 8 to fill and cover the radial spaces between theinward projections 6, and thus serve as a closed kettle rest.
To support the star-like lid 7 thus formed flush in its corresponding opening 5, I prefer to cast integrally with the solid top 4-, across and beneath the outer ends of some of the radial spaces between the fingers 6, shelves 9 on which the outer ends of the lid projections 8 rest.
To provide for effective ventilation, combustion and heating when the closed top is used, I prefer to space slightly the corresponding edges of the fingers 6 and lid projections or fillers 8, and bevel the same inwardly and downwardly so that the beveled edges 10 of the lid will cover but not close the intervening spaces.
I may also to the same end as illustrated in Figure 3, scallop, indent or serrate the edges of the fingers and top at intervals around the fillers 8 and close the beveled joints between the fingers and fillers, so that the expansion of the top and lid over the lighted burner will cause the lid to be lifted and rise above the solid top, and thus open without uncovering the spaces at the scallops, indentations or serrations 11.
The lids 7 may of course be joined in pairs or otherwise according as the corresponding openings 5 are separate or connected, and each lid is provided with the usual socket 12 to receive the lid lifter.
